Ticketless train travel to be trialled across cities
Ticketless train travel using location-based technology is being trialled by East Midlands Railway (EMR) and Northern in England, aiming to simplify fare calculations for passengers travelling through Derby, Leicester, Nottingham, and Yorkshire. The GPS tracking system will charge passengers the best fare at the end of the day, potentially offering savings and convenience. The trials have sparked discussions on modernizing rail ticketing systems and improving passenger experiences, with some highlighting the importance of ensuring accessibility for all.
